Global Health Principles-Monitoring and Evaluation Resource Guide--2014  

This guide was created in 2014 by the U.S. government with the support of Measure Evaluation in order to provide a standard, cohesive, and evidence based approach to monitoring and sustaining progress toward the Global Health Initiative’s (GBH) principles. Interagency teams worked together, with MEASURE/Evaluation, to explore existing monitoring approaches, review the evidence, and develop meaningful and specific indicators.
